On the subject of Alex's cause of death: In an in-depth podcast interview with a small youtuber from two months ago, det. Ray Hermosillo stated that he had suspected foul play until he received info on Alex's Google searches. Apparently a week before he died, Alex was googling multiple symptoms, including "Why do I have shortness of breath?", "Why am I tired?" and "Why am I dizzy?". This was well before Tammy was exhumed. I remember his and Lori's niece Melani also claiming in her old interviews that Alex was having health issues in the week before he died, but since she was lying about so many things, nobody believed her at the time.
 
In another exchange from the same interview, det. Hermosillo was asked if he believed there were any members of Chad's cult left who could continue on his path. He replied that Chad's cult was his mini harem which was dismantled during the investigation and that there wasn't potential for it to continue, because the participants (but clearly not Lori) realized they had been fooled.
